So the first pigment I ever purchased, many years ago now was Mac's Blue Brown pigment. A pigment which I've recently fallen back in love with! Granted its not an every day kind of shade but it is a beauty none the less! The pigment also has a reddish tint to it which is perfect particularly if you have green eyes like me :-)
I have swatches the shade below so you can see it alone and also when applied on top of a black base (I used Illamasqua Entangle cream eyeshadow, but you could use a Mac paint pot or just a basic kohl liner) the other swatch is when I have added Mac's Reflex Transparent Teal pigment on top for extra sparkles! (L-R)
I think you will agree its a great shade and the two tone makes it different to other pigments out there (although Illamasqua do a similar one)
I have used the pigment all over the base of my eye in the picture below but if you aren't bold enough a little of this shade in the outer corners and crease will look fab!
I have blended the shade with Mac's Embark eyeshadow which is a matt reddish brown shade and highlighted using Mac's All That Glitters on the brow bone and inner corner.
Finished with a little black eyeshadow in the outer corners and a gel liner along the lash line (top and bottom)

The pigment like all Mac pigments will last you all day or night provided you use a primer first.
